We have obtained the spectrum of β‐poly(L‐alanine‐ND), and find three bands in the ND stretching region. By comparison with Fermi resonance analyses of deuterated derivatives of polyglycine I as well as with α‐poly(L‐alanine‐ND), we conclude that a three‐level Fermi resonance is involved in the β polypeptide, and that the unperturbed ND stretch fundamental occurs near 2428 cm −1 .
